You have answered your own question. You know you will need a sub. You want to change to a powered setup. The PA you are using right now is not designed to give the best sound for a DJ application. It would be better suited for maybe a live singer and guitar player in a coffee shop. The "mixer" is a powered mixer, i.e. that mixer has the amp built in and is designed to work with those specific speakers.
You want to spend $100 on a light effect. A light will not fix the problem of inadequate sound. All it will do is satisfy your need for a new piece of gear. Don't give in to the temptation.
My advice? Save your money. More specifically, Save $1200. If you are charging $200 to do a show right now, save half of it for the next 12 shows. Then, go out and buy 2 Mackie SRM450's. If you are lucky, you might find a package deal that includes a couple stands.
Then sell your current PA. Sell it on EBay as a complete PA. Set the reserve at $400.
Then raise your current rate to do an event by 25%. Add that 25% to the $100 you already have been saving from each event. Then add the amount you sell your current PA for to what you have saved and buy one sub. If you have any money left after buying a sub, THEN look at getting a light effect.
